Output e80ba105c21a09b9dfc59cdbd46fd613c243d7546cd8efd8180bb130d927572b:50

value
709039
script pubkey
OP_0 OP_PUSHBYTES_20 eb15bc4e2562ae359102b114112391b7447f5bf8
address
bc1qav2mcn39v2hrtygzky2pzgu3kaz87klcwavzq2
transaction
e80ba105c21a09b9dfc59cdbd46fd613c243d7546cd8efd8180bb130d927572b
spent
true